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
882064 0211 08036
46 2200 67318497073
46 2200 67318497073
54309624550 244 595899429 576857538
All about undefined
Interested in learning more?
46 2200 67318497073
54309624550 244 595899429 576857538
See more
4324232 799
023536 0740 55 966
See more
616149450 1598508937 661687
2052287 15 549
See more